python编译一个哆啦a梦
时间: 2023-11-18 12:03:14 浏览: 130
作为AI语言模型,我无法编译出一个真正的哆啦A梦。哆啦A梦是一个动画角色,它的图像和声音都是由动画制作公司制作的。但是,如果你想要使用Python语言绘制一个哆啦A梦的图像,你可以使用Python的turtle库来实现。以下是一个简单的示例代码:
```python
import turtle
# 设置画布大小和背景颜色
turtle.setup(width=800, height=600)
turtle.bgcolor("#00A2E8")
# 绘制哆啦A梦的身体
turtle.penup()
turtle.goto(0, 0)
turtle.pendown()
turtle.pensize(10)
turtle.pencolor("#FDB813")
turtle.fillcolor("#FDB813")
turtle.begin_fill()
turtle.circle(150)
turtle.end_fill()
# 绘制哆啦A梦的脸部
turtle.penup()
turtle.goto(0, 150)
turtle.pendown()
turtle.pensize(10)
turtle.pencolor("#FFFFFF")
turtle.fillcolor("#FFFFFF")
turtle.begin_fill()
turtle.circle(100)
turtle.end_fill()
# 绘制哆啦A梦的眼睛
turtle.penup()
turtle.goto(-50, 200)
turtle.pendown()
turtle.pensize(10)
turtle.pencolor("#000000")
turtle.fillcolor("#000000")
turtle.begin_fill()
turtle.circle(30)
turtle.end_fill()
turtle.penup()
turtle.goto(50, 200)
turtle.pendown()
turtle.pensize(10)
turtle.pencolor("#000000")
turtle.fillcolor("#000000")
turtle.begin_fill()
turtle.circle(30)
turtle.end_fill()
# 绘制哆啦A梦的鼻子和嘴巴
turtle.penup()
turtle.goto(0, 150)
turtle.pendown()
turtle.pensize(10)
turtle.pencolor("#FF0000")
turtle.fillcolor("#FF0000")
turtle.begin_fill()
turtle.circle(20)
turtle.end_fill()
turtle.penup()
turtle.goto(0, 100)
turtle.pendown()
turtle.pensize(10)
turtle.pencolor("#000000")
turtle.right(90)
turtle.circle(50, 180)
turtle.penup()
turtle.goto(0, 100)
turtle.pendown()
turtle.pensize(10)
turtle.pencolor("#000000")
turtle.left(180)
turtle.circle(-50, 180)
# 绘制哆啦A梦的胡须
turtle.penup()
turtle.goto(-80, 120)
turtle.pendown()
turtle.pensize(5)
turtle.pencolor("#000000")
turtle.right(20)
turtle.forward(100)
turtle.penup()
turtle.goto(-80, 100)
turtle.pendown()
turtle.pensize(5)
turtle.pencolor("#000000")
turtle.right(20)
turtle.forward(100)
turtle.penup()
turtle.goto(-80, 80)
turtle.pendown()
turtle.pensize(5)
turtle.pencolor("#000000")
turtle.right(20)
turtle.forward(100)
turtle.penup()
turtle.goto(80, 120)
turtle.pendown()
turtle.pensize(5)
turtle.pencolor("#000000")
turtle.left(20)
turtle.forward(100)
turtle.penup()
turtle.goto(80, 100)
turtle.pendown()
turtle.pensize(5)
turtle.pencolor("#000000")
turtle.left(20)
turtle.forward(100)
turtle.penup()
turtle.goto(80, 80)
turtle.pendown()
turtle.pensize(5)
turtle.pencolor("#000000")
turtle.left(20)
turtle.forward(100)
# 隐藏海龟
turtle.hideturtle()
# 等待用户关闭窗口
turtle.done()
```
运行以上代码,你就可以得到一个哆啦A梦的图像。当然,这只是一个简单的示例,如果你想要绘制一个更逼真的哆啦A梦,你需要更多的绘图技巧和耐心。
阅读全文